Aromatic Exploration: Deconstructing the YSL L'Homme Scent
Understanding YSL L'Homme requires understanding its composition. While the exact percentages of each ingredient remain a closely guarded secret, the prevalent notes provide a clear picture of the fragrance's character. Referencing various sources, including Fragrantica reviews and expert analyses, we can identify key components within the YSL L'Homme notes:
* Top Notes: The initial burst of YSL L'Homme often features a vibrant blend of citrus fruits, primarily bergamot and grapefruit. This bright, zesty opening provides a refreshing and invigorating start, cutting through any heaviness that might otherwise dominate. A subtle spiciness, perhaps from cardamom or pepper, adds a layer of complexity, preventing the citrus from feeling overly simplistic.
* Heart Notes: As the top notes begin to fade, the heart of YSL L'Homme reveals itself. Here, we find a more nuanced and sophisticated palette. Violet leaves, often described as possessing a powdery, slightly green character, contribute a unique softness. This is balanced by a subtly sweet and woody undertone, likely derived from cedar and other aromatic woods. The overall impression is one of refined elegance, a comfortable masculinity that avoids being overly assertive.
* Base Notes: The base notes of YSL L'Homme provide the fragrance with its lasting power and depth. Vetiver, a prominent earthy note, anchors the composition, lending a grounding quality. Amber adds warmth and a touch of sweetness, while cedarwood continues to contribute its characteristic woody aroma. The overall effect is a warm, sensual base that lingers on the skin, creating a lasting impression.
The interplay between these notes is what makes YSL L'Homme so captivating. It's not a linear fragrance; it evolves throughout its wear, revealing different facets depending on the stage and the wearer's skin chemistry. This dynamic nature contributes to its enduring appeal and explains why it remains a popular choice for many men.
Critical Acclaim and Online Discourse: The YSL L'Homme Review Landscape
The fragrance world is a vibrant ecosystem of opinions and experiences. Online platforms like Fragrantica serve as important hubs for fragrance enthusiasts to share their thoughts and experiences. Examining the YSL L'Homme review landscape across various platforms reveals a generally positive reception. Many users praise its versatility, describing it as appropriate for both daytime and evening wear, making it a practical addition to any man's collection.
